Re: Nickel silver bolsters
Flitz is more abrasive than Simichrome, but they both have their uses. On nickle-silver or brass Simichrome is great, but it exposes new high shine metal which oxidizes more readily, so seal immediately with Renaissance or shoe polish (and yes only the price seems different.) For stainless, like blades, Flitz is faster and will remove fine scratches. Most factory blades are chemically polished (a type of etching) and thus appear satin or even slightly grainy. Buffing manually or with a felt wheel (Dremel) will make a noticeable improvement. Then use Simichrome. Note, it can be too agressive. It works well on horn and bone, but will chew into plastics, especially with a felt wheel. Think Flitz for hard materials (steel, bone) and Simichrome for softer. Always try the gentle one first and proceed with caution. If you want even more shine, try Pink Scratchless or Diamond paste (the smaller the micron, the finer the cut).
